The Global Interventional Imaging Solutions Market is valued at approximately USD 23.87 billion in 2026 and is projected to expand at a CAGR of around 7.3% from 2026 to 2033, reaching USD 43.98 billion by 2033.
The Global Interventional Imaging Solutions Market is witnessing steady growth as healthcare systems increasingly adopt advanced imaging technologies to support minimally invasive procedures. Interventional imaging solutions—including X-ray fluoroscopy, MRI, CT, and ultrasound—play a crucial role in guiding real-time diagnosis and treatment, particularly in cardiology, oncology, and neurology. The market is expanding due to the rising prevalence of chronic diseases such as cardiovascular disorders and cancer, along with the growing aging population that requires advanced medical interventions. Additionally, continuous technological advancements, including AI-driven imaging, improved image resolution, and integrated imaging systems, are enhancing procedural accuracy and patient outcomes, thereby driving demand across hospitals and specialized care centers. From a growth perspective, the market is primarily driven by the increasing preference for minimally invasive procedures, which reduce recovery time, lower risks, and improve clinical efficiency.

Market Drivers:
The key drivers of the Global Interventional Imaging Solutions Market is the increasing preference for minimally invasive procedures among patients and healthcare providers. These procedures offer significant advantages, including reduced surgical risks, shorter hospital stays, and faster recovery times. Interventional imaging solutions such as fluoroscopy, CT, and ultrasound play a vital role in guiding these procedures with high precision and real-time visualization. For instance, in 2025, Terumo Corporation secured FDA 510(k) clearance for its OPUSWAVE Dual Sensor Imaging System, integrating OFDI and IVUS technologies. This innovation enhanced diagnostic accuracy in minimally invasive procedures, strengthened clinical decision-making, and accelerated demand, thereby driving growth in the global interventional imaging solutions market.
As healthcare systems focus on improving patient outcomes and reducing overall treatment costs, the adoption of image-guided interventions continues to rise, thereby fueling demand for advanced interventional imaging technologies across hospitals and ambulatory care centers.
Another major driver is the rising incidence of chronic diseases such as cardiovascular disorders, cancer, and neurological conditions, which require accurate diagnosis and targeted treatment. The increasing aging population further amplifies this demand, as older individuals are more susceptible to such conditions. Interventional imaging solutions enable early detection, precise treatment planning, and minimally invasive therapeutic procedures, making them essential in modern healthcare. Additionally, continuous advancements in imaging technologies, including AI integration and enhanced imaging capabilities, are improving diagnostic accuracy and procedural efficiency, further driving the growth of the interventional imaging solutions market globally.
Market Restraints:
One of the key restraints in the Global Interventional Imaging Solutions Market is the high cost associated with advanced imaging systems and the infrastructure required for their installation and operation. Equipment such as MRI, CT scanners, and hybrid imaging systems involve substantial capital investment, making them less accessible for small and mid-sized healthcare facilities, particularly in developing regions. In addition to the initial purchase cost, ongoing expenses related to maintenance, software upgrades, and skilled personnel further increase the financial burden. The need for specialized infrastructure, such as radiation-shielded rooms and advanced IT integration, also limits widespread adoption. These cost-related challenges can slow down procurement decisions and restrict market growth despite the increasing demand for image-guided interventions.
Segmental Analysis:
X-ray and fluoroscopy systems hold a significant share in the interventional imaging solutions market due to their widespread use in real-time image-guided procedures. These systems provide continuous imaging, enabling clinicians to monitor instruments and guide interventions such as catheter placements and stent insertions with high precision. Their relatively lower cost compared to advanced modalities like MRI and CT makes them more accessible across a wide range of healthcare facilities. Additionally, ongoing advancements in digital fluoroscopy, including improved image clarity and reduced radiation exposure, are enhancing their clinical utility. The increasing number of cardiovascular and orthopedic procedures further supports the strong demand for X-ray and fluoroscopy systems globally.
Hybrid imaging systems are gaining strong traction in the market due to their ability to combine multiple imaging modalities into a single platform. These systems, often used in hybrid operating rooms, integrate technologies such as CT, MRI, and fluoroscopy to support complex and minimally invasive procedures. They enable enhanced visualization, improved procedural accuracy, and better patient outcomes, making them highly valuable in advanced surgical settings. The growing demand for precision medicine and image-guided therapies is driving the adoption of hybrid systems. Although these systems involve high installation costs, their ability to streamline workflows and reduce procedure time is encouraging healthcare providers to invest in them.
Cardiology is one of the leading application segments in the interventional imaging solutions market, driven by the increasing prevalence of cardiovascular diseases worldwide. Interventional imaging plays a crucial role in procedures such as angioplasty, stent placement, and cardiac catheterization, where real-time visualization is essential. The growing aging population and rising incidence of lifestyle-related heart conditions are further boosting demand for advanced imaging technologies in cardiology. Additionally, continuous innovations in imaging techniques, such as high-resolution fluoroscopy and 3D imaging, are improving procedural accuracy and patient outcomes. This has led to increased adoption of interventional imaging solutions in cardiac care units and specialized heart centers.
Angiography is a key procedure segment that significantly contributes to the demand for interventional imaging solutions. It involves the use of imaging techniques to visualize blood vessels and diagnose conditions such as blockages, aneurysms, and vascular abnormalities. Interventional imaging systems, particularly fluoroscopy and CT, are essential for performing angiographic procedures with high precision. The increasing prevalence of cardiovascular and vascular diseases is driving the demand for angiography worldwide. Additionally, advancements in imaging technologies, including digital subtraction angiography and real-time imaging, are enhancing diagnostic accuracy and treatment outcomes. This makes angiography a critical component of modern interventional radiology practices.
Hospitals represent the largest end-user segment in the interventional imaging solutions market due to their comprehensive healthcare services and advanced infrastructure. They are the primary centers for complex diagnostic and interventional procedures, requiring a wide range of imaging systems. Hospitals benefit from higher patient inflow, skilled medical professionals, and the availability of hybrid operating rooms, which support the adoption of advanced imaging technologies. Additionally, increasing investments in healthcare infrastructure and the expansion of multispecialty hospitals are driving demand for interventional imaging solutions. The need for accurate diagnosis and minimally invasive treatment options further strengthens the dominance of hospitals in this segment.

North America is expected to witness the highest growth in the Global Interventional Imaging Solutions Market over the forecast period, driven by advanced healthcare infrastructure and early adoption of cutting-edge medical technologies.
The region benefits from strong investments in research and development, along with the presence of leading market players and well-established hospitals. Increasing prevalence of chronic diseases such as cardiovascular disorders and cancer is significantly boosting the demand for interventional imaging procedures. For instance, in 2024, GE HealthCare and MediView XR deployed the OmnifyXR Interventional Suite at a U.S. clinical site, integrating augmented reality with advanced imaging. This innovation enhanced procedural precision and collaboration, strengthening technological adoption and accelerating growth in North America’s interventional imaging solutions market.
Additionally, the growing adoption of minimally invasive treatments and AI-enabled imaging systems is accelerating market expansion. Favorable reimbursement policies and continuous technological advancements further support North America’s position as a key high-growth region.
